Welcome to 26 Banjo Crescent, Gilston-an architecturally crafted family retreat that seamlessly blends elegance, privacy, and the beauty of the Gilston hinterland reserve. This remarkable home captivates with its charm, tranquility, and sophisticated design.

As you stroll along the inviting decked pathway, through lush tropical gardens, and approach the striking front entrance, a sense of quality and serenity envelops you.

This peaceful haven radiates positive energy, fostering a lifestyle of relaxation and harmony. The grandeur of vaulted ceilings in the expansive living area, the warmth of superior spotted gum flooring, and the stunning stone benchtop in the kitchen-offering a picturesque view of the sparkling pool through stacking windows-are just a few of the standout features of this exquisite home.

Read the full description

Designed with thoughtful precision, the residence boasts an open-plan living and dining space, ensuring ample room for the entire family to unwind in complete comfort. At its heart lies a contemporary kitchen, complete with premium granite benchtops, soft-close cabinetry, sleek 2 Pac finishes, a gas cooktop, and high-quality appliances.

Situated in a peaceful cul-de-sac, this home features four generously sized bedrooms and three well-appointed bathrooms. Two master suites include private ensuites, with one offering a separate entrance-ideal for teenagers, extended family, or guests seeking added privacy.

Step outside to the beautifully designed undercover deck, a perfect setting for entertaining family and friends. On warm summer days, cool off in the glistening saltwater pool while taking in the uninterrupted reserve views.

This rare gem is sure to be in high demand!

Key Features:

• Four spacious bedrooms, including two luxurious master suites

• Expansive open-plan living/dining area with soaring raked ceilings and full-length windows

• High-quality "Shark Screen" security screens on all windows and doors

• Superior spotted gum hardwood timber flooring

• Large fan-forced wood-burning fireplace

• Three reverse-cycle air-conditioning units and quality ceiling fans throughout

• Hinterland reserve forms part of a protected environmental belt, ensuring permanent scenic views

• Beautifully landscaped, low-maintenance gardens with flowering plants and fruit trees

• Surround decking designed for entertaining

• Stylish kitchen with premium granite benchtops, soft-close cabinetry, 2 Pac finishes, gas cooktop, and high-end appliances

• Marble accents in bathrooms and laundry

• Living area directly facing tranquil bushland

• 8-metre saltwater pool with a premium chlorinator

• Expansive under-house storage area, perfect for a workshop, play zone, or hobbies

• 5kW solar system with 26 panels

• Picturesque timber bridge leading to an impressive front entrance

• 5000-litre water tank

• Rear gate providing direct access to the reserve

• Adjustable shade umbrella over the pool area

• Intercom system

• Ceiling fans in the covered pool space

• Automated double garage with built-in shelving

• Gas hot water system

• Council Rates: $1,995.96 per annum (approx.)

• Water Rates: $964.40 per annum (approx. - excluding usage)

• Rental Appraisal: $1250 to $1300 per week (approx.)

Nestled in one of Gilston's most sought-after family-friendly communities, this residence offers a serene lifestyle surrounded by pristine natural bushland and abundant wildlife, while still being close to all modern conveniences.

Ideally located just a short drive from multiple shopping centres, schools such as Gilston and Nerang State School, parks, and essential amenities, with quick access to the M1 motorway. The world-famous Gold Coast beaches are also just a short drive away.
